I haven't been to evans. Walker is a very tight in places so body damage can happen. But good driving should keep the body dent free. It still will get scraped up but nothing to deep. I would say 3 inch lift and 31s should be all that is needed for walker.

But the last time I ran walker I was in a yj with 33s and 4 inch lift.
